Role Purpose
Build and operate the data pipelines that feed the Entity Hub. This role lands all six in-scope sources into Fabric, implements standardization and transformation logic, and maintains the data quality checks and monitoring that the entity resolution engine depends on. Reliable, observable ingestion is the foundation the entire programme rests on.
Key Responsibilities
- Ingestion development — build and maintain pipelines to land the six in-scope sources (Secretary of State, D&B;, ARROW, E1, hCue, DocCentral) into the Fabric Bronze/raw layer.
- Mirroring & CDC — implement Fabric Mirroring for supported structured sources and establish change-data-capture patterns; implement watermark/incremental load logic where mirroring is unavailable.
- Raw layer management — maintain one Delta table per source on an append-only basis, retaining evidence records and full source provenance.
- Standardization & transformation — implement name normalization, address parsing and attribute standardization logic in Spark notebooks; support identifier-spine construction.
- Data quality — implement data quality checks, validation rules, threshold alerts and exception handling; support reconciliation against source.
- Pipeline operations — schedule, monitor and troubleshoot pipeline runs; investigate failures and performance issues; maintain run documentation.
- Performance tuning — optimise Spark jobs, Delta file sizes, partitioning and pipeline efficiency to manage Fabric capacity consumption.
- Documentation — produce and maintain source-to-target mappings, transformation logic documentation and lineage records.
Required Skills & Experience
Skill Area
Specific Requirements
Core Engineering
Python, PySpark, advanced SQL, Delta Lake, distributed data processing
Microsoft Fabric
Data Factory pipelines and Copy Activity, Lakehouse, OneLake, Spark notebooks, Environments, Mirroring,
Shortcuts
Data Integration
Batch and incremental ingestion, CDC patterns, watermarking, reprocessing strategies, schema-on-read for wide-ranging formats
Data Quality
Validation rule implementation, completeness/accuracy checks, alerting, exception workflows, reconciliation
Modelling
Bronze/Silver/Gold medallion layering, cleansing and conformance, standardization of names, addresses, dates and codes
Ops & Governance
Pipeline monitoring, lineage and metadata capture, access controls, technical documentation
